UTAC is a market-leading international group in digital & sustainable mobility, customisable testing solutions, customisable testing systems, vehicle engineering, homologation, regulatory advice & expertise, certification, training, corporate events and classic & sportscars festivals.

The Group provides services and systems to customers in the various sectors: mobility, transport, tyre, petrochemical, agriculture and defence industries. UTAC operates test centres and laboratories in France (including the official Euro NCAP facility), the UK, USA, Finland, Morocco, and Germany; it has subsidiaries in China, Korea and Japan. UTAC employs around 1300 people across its various locations.

Job Description



As a Test Cell Operator, you will be responsible for operating and supporting dynamometer test cells for propulsion and driveline systems. This includes working with dynamometer control software to integrate customer test requests, performing test equipment calibrations, and executing troubleshooting efforts on test cell equipment.  

Roles and Responsibilities 

  • Operating and supporting dynamometer testing in-house developed dynamometer control software; this includes configuring channel setups and writing automated test scripts among many other items
  • Translating documents and conversations from customers to fully functional dynamometer test
  • Troubleshooting of testing systems and customer product issues
  • Collaborating with interdisciplinary teams to create concepts and deliverables used to efficiently complete customer test requests and internal projects
  • Setting up small scale testing equipment including analog sensors, electrical instruments, cooling systems, and other customer driven requirements 
  • Electrical wiring of internal and external sensors to our data acquisition system and our industrial drive systems
  • Calibrating testing equipment such as torque meters, pressure sensors, and flow meters
